Bought in smaller and larger size. I think smaller is better if you are on the line.
I have both a small and the larger size of this… I believe after a few time wearing they stretch out enough that if you are on the line of sizes it’s better to get the smaller size (I wear a size 8 and have kind of wide feed). Provides great ankle support and is helping me correct my gate, I turned my foot outward, and it affects my knee and my hip. I have hypermobile EDS in this provides really great support while still allowing my muscles to strengthen around the joint.I like that this has an open toe so that I can wear it with flip-flops or slides and not feel completely silly, plus I just don’t like compression socks. I also bought a calf compression sleeve and the two seemed to work well together. I initially used only the ankle sleeve though and it’s worked really well (besides the larger one eventually stretching enough I didn’t feel it was tight enough anymore). It’s just when things are flared up more than normal I like to use both.
